(1,0) gauge theories on the six-sphere
Authors: Usman Naseer
Preprint number: UUITP-38/18
We construct gauge theories with a vector-multiplet and hypermultiplets of (1,0) supersymmetry on the six-sphere. The gauge coupling on the sphere depends on the polar angle. This has a natural explanation in terms of the tensor branch of (1,0) theories on the six-sphere. For the vector-multiplet we give an off-shell formulation for all supersymmetries. For hypermultiplets we give an off-shell formulation for one supersymmetry. We show that the path integral for the vector- multiplet localizes to solutions of the Hermitian-Yang-Mills equation, which is a generalization of the (anti-)self duality condition to higher dimensions. For the hypermultiplet, the path integral localizes to configurations where the field strengths of two complex scalars are related by an almost complex structure.
